Synthesis, structure and optical limiting property of CoII, MnII and CdII complexes with di-Schiff base and reduced di-Schiff base ligands

Three coordination polymers [Co(L)(2)(SCN)(2)] (1), [Mn(L)(2)(SCN)(2)] (2) and [Cd(H4L)(2)Cl-2] (3), were obtained by the reaction of Co-II, Mn-II, Cd-II salts with di-Schiff base ligand N,N-bis(3-pyridylmethyl)-4,4'-biphenylenedimethyleneimine (L) and its reduced form (H4L), respectively and their structures were determined by X-ray crystallography. In the solid state, complexes 1 and 2 feature 1D hinged chains, while complex 3 has a 2D network structure. Complex 2 was found to show optical limiting property with a 3 ns pulsed laser at 532 nm in DMF solution. (c) 2005 Elsevier B.V. All rights reserved.
